Course Curriculum Overview

5

Every semester has 6 theory subjects and 4 lab curriculum. In first year three 3 credit subjects and three 2 credit subjects. The lab sessional has 1.5 grade pay. Each semester has 22 credits and results are provided in Cgpa. The lab sessional are really very helpful and need to be attained carefully. Each year has 2 semesters. But for VSSUT you need to clear each semester by 4 months with holidays and others days.

Placement Experience

4

Placement in the college are decent good. But within the recent years there is high fluctuations in the placement. Many many new companies arrives every year and picks deleberately a strong percentage of placement. The highest package is 47 Lpa and average is 5Lpa . Percentage of students getting placed are 60 to 70% .

Fees and Financial Aid

For the first year the we need to pay entirely for the year that is 89000 rupees and from second year onwards you need to pay semester wise where the hostel fees are 17000 per semester and tution fees are 21000 rupees per semester till the last semester for my academic year 2023-27 the entire 21000 rupees includes all the accommodation fees also. There is a category of tution fees waiver scheme by the government where the tuition fees are weived and reduced to 12000 rupees per semester . Only 6 to 7% students get available this TFW schemes. We can avail many government based scholarship like e medhabruti for all the categories, post metric scholarship for SC ST AND EBC ( Economically backward class) , and Kalia scholarship for for people whose family enrolled under Kalia scheme. Other private scholarships are also included. Like JSW UDAAN scholarship for students belonging to designated locations like Sambalpur, jharsuguda, Jagatsinghpur and more one or two places. Btech students gets 20000 rupees under e medhabruti scholarship and same for post metric scholarship for EBC category students. The SC ST students get more than 50k as a scholarship once in every year. Same goes for the Kalia scholarship holders. The JSW UDAAN scholarship pays nearly 35k to the beneficiaries. All the scholarship are annual. None of the above scholarship are merit based all are category based and no limit for the number of applicants.

Campus Life

5

Every year three fests takes place that are sports fest ( ILLUMINA) The technical fest (SAMAVESH) And the cultural fest ( VSSAUNT) The sports fest takes place during December - January and the technical and cultural fest takes place later on. Very large library is present within the campus accessible for card holders. You can also borrow books free for 14 days. Sports clubs , technical clubs , cultural clubs are also present for students co curricular activities.

Hostel Facilities

4

In the first year students live in the pulaha hall of residence in which each room has 3 students alloted to them in a random order. And from next year onwards on other hostels each room has 4 students. For first year hostel development fees are taken as 14k and a overall 48k for first year hostel fees. And next year onwards 34k as hostel fees . Online fees payment on college website.

Placement Experience:

Placements at KIIT University for B.Tech CSE are decent and well structured, especially for students who prepare consistently. Students become eligible for campus placements from the 7th semester, although pre placement talks training sessions and internships start from the 5th or 6th semester. The university has a centralized placement cell that coordinates training aptitude tests mock interviews and company drives. Many reputed companies visit the campus every year including TCS Infosys Wipro Accenture Cognizant Capgemini Deloitte EY Mindtree LTI Bosch HP Amazon and a few product based startups. Mass recruiters make a large number of offers while product and service based companies offer selective roles. The average package for CSE students usually ranges between 4 to 5 LPA, while the highest package can go above 20 to 25 LPA in exceptional cases depending on the company and role such as software developer or data engineer. Around 75 to 85 percent of CSE students get placed through campus placements. Students who remain unplaced usually pursue higher studies startups off campus jobs or competitive exam preparation. Placement success largely depends on individual effort coding skills internships and communication ability.
